Introduction

The world of Tukayyid was primarily an agricultural world in the Free Rasalhague Republic at the time of the Clan Invasion. The world was picked to be the site of a proxy battle fought for control of Terra between the Clans led by ilKhan Ulric Kerensky and ComStar's ComGuard led by Precentor Martial Anastasius Focht. The actual battle was broken down into ComGuard-defended objectives that the Clans would try to conquer. If the majority of these targets were conquered by the Clans then Terra would be allowed to fall into which ever clan could advance to it first. If the ComGuard successfully defended the majority of the targets, then the Clans had to abide by a 15 year truce with the Inner Sphere in which no Clan elements would cross the plane emanating from Tukayyid and extending to the edges of the Inner Sphere perpendicular to the Clan Occupation Zones.

The Battles

The Clans bid fiercely for targets and perhaps were reckless in their own self-confidence and lack of respect for the ComGuard. They planned for a quick campaign, resembling those that they fought in the initial invasion of the Inner Sphere. However, the ComGuard by now had studied Clan tactics to a great extent, and devised a defensive doctrine aimed specifically at wearing down the Clans' forces through stealth and cunning rather than brute force.

Of all the Clans that invaded Tukayyid, only one (Clan Wolf) achieved a victory over the ComGuards (mainly because of their partial adoption of new tactics). Only Clan Ghost Bear succeeded in achieving a draw, while the other five Clans lost, giving the ComGuard a comfortable majority of battle victories.

Results

The ComGuard won a resounding victory at Tukayyid that stopped the Clan juggernaut in its tracks and bought the Inner Sphere 15 years to prepare for a resumption of hostilities from Clans below the truce line. The victory also elevated Precentor Martial Anastasius Focht to nothing short of a legend within both the Inner Sphere and the Clans.
